Climatologist Ed Hawkins designed the "Warming Stripes" (also known as "Climate Stripes") as a visualization of our planet's warming over time. The progression from blue (cooler) to red (warmer) stripes portrays the long-term increase of average global temperature from 1850 (hoist side of the flag) to 2018 (fly edge). This graph is a beautiful way to display the terrifying reality of climate change.
